BIBEAU v. FOREST MANOR NURSING HOME

No. 2005-CA-0181.

917 So.2d 1123 (2005)

Mark F. BIBEAU v. FOREST MANOR NURSING HOME, Heritage Manor Nursing Home, and M. McGregor Jones Health Care Center a/k/a Prayer Tower Rest Home.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, Fourth Circuit.

August 18, 2005.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Harry E. Forst, New Orleans, LA, for Plaintiff/Appellant.

John A. Stassi II, Alison A. Bradley, Christovich & Kearney LLP, New Orleans, LA, for Defendant/Appellee.

(Court composed of Chief Judge JOAN BERNARD ARMSTRONG, Judge PATRICIA RIVET MURRAY and JUDGE MAX N. TOBIAS JR.).


JOAN BERNARD ARMSTRONG, Chief Judge.

The plaintiff-appellant, Mark F. Bibeau, appeals a judgment dismissing his suit against the defendant-appellee, Forest Manor Nursing Home, without prejudice on the basis of abandonment under La. C.C.P. art. 561.
